
As a well established 8-piece band featuring 3-piece horn section “The
Brass Monkeys”, Madison Kat know how to bust it commanding the
audience’s attention from the outset. Playing styles including
funk, ska, swing & alternative as well as recognizable cuts from
past and contemporary artists, they use their youthful experience to
read the crowd and play accordingly, urging all to get down, whilst not
playing “the same old” cliché cover-band music.
Established in 1969, Madison Kat are continuing a strong musical tradition that
has forged through generations. The boys thrive on edgy live perfomance throwing
out a soundwall of grooves, harmonies and effects. They are always freshening
their extensive cover track repetoire with their own style of musicality, and
are now introducing their own material into the set. With the goal near of recording
an EP, the boys are pumped about getting these new tunes out there to let everybody
know what the next phase of the band is about.
